Avatar billede zoq Nybegynder
22. marts 2004 - 23:36 Der er 20 kommentarer og
1 løsning

Boot problemer! Grub

ARGH det går da helt galt det her.

Jeg havde en server hvor jeg tidligere havde 3 harddiske i.
80 gb - Linux Fedora
80 gb - Windows 2003 server
160 gb - filer mm.

Jeg fjernede harddisken med filer og harddisken med windows 2003 og startede så min server op igen. (skal lige siges at den havde dual boot tidligere med LILO)

Jeg roder og roder frem og tilbage - sætter den gamle harddisk med Windows 2003 tilbage i serveren så de nu sidder sådan her:
----------------------------
Primary Master: Linux disken
Primary Slave: Windows 2003

har også gjort det omvendt så de sidder sådan her
----------------------------
Primary Master: Linux disken
Primary Slave: Windows 2003

Men hver gang jeg booter op får jeg skiftevis (alt efter hvad der sidder som Primary Master og Primary Slave:

"GRUB hard disk error"
eller
"Fejl ved indlæsning af operativsystem.

Mega surt - er der en som kan for tælle hvad jeg skal gøre. Har lidt på fornemmelsen at der skal laves noget i BIOS ?
Avatar billede Slettet bruger
23. marts 2004 - 19:31 #1
Det er lidt svært at vide hvad du helt præcis mener idet du både taler om Grub og Lilo, men hvis vi holder os til Grub skal
du ind logge på som root og redigere filen /boot/grub/menu.lst
Jeg vil anbefale dig at jumpe dine harddiske således at din primære master indeholder Windows og din sekundære master indeholder
Linux
Nedenstående eksempel skulle næsten kunne bruges du skal dog selv indsætte den rigtige sti, herefter skal du naturligvis skrive
til MBR hvis du ikke kender det så meld tilbage 




title Linux
    kernel (hd1,4)/boot/vmlinuz root=/dev/hdb5 vga=0x317 splash=silent desktop hdd=ide-scsi hddlun=0 showopts
    initrd (hd1,4)/boot/initrd

title Windows
    root (hd0,0)
    chainloader +1


title Floppy
    root (fd0)
    chainloader +1

title Failsafe
    kernel (hd1,4)/boot/vmlinuz root=/dev/hdb5 showopts ide=nodma apm=off acpi=off vga=normal nosmp noapic maxcpus=0 3
Avatar billede zoq Nybegynder
23. marts 2004 - 20:11 #2
okay....!

Jeg sætter Linux til Primary Master og Windows til Secondary Master og det er gjort nu (skal nemlig have min windows disk helt væk på et tidspunkt - så støder jeg nok ikke på problemer senere når jeg fjerner min Secondary Master)

>du ind logge på som root og redigere filen /boot/grub/menu.lst

Hvordan kan jeg komme ind i Linux når jeg får fejlen... kan man lave en boot CD ? Kiggede på det her:
https://www.redhat.com/docs/manuals/linux/RHL-9-Manual/install-guide/s1-x86-starting.html#S2-X86-STARTING-BOOTING

men det forklarer kun hvordan man laver en boot cd via Linux.

Er det overhovedet en Boot CD jeg skal lave ?
Avatar billede Slettet bruger
23. marts 2004 - 20:32 #3
Jeg kender ikke helt RH jeg kører selv Suse men jeg mener du booter op på Cd 1, inden boot for du mulighed for at vælge en menu her mener jeg du skal vælge "rescue" det er vist nok F5 så er det blot at følge vejledningen på skærmen
Avatar billede zoq Nybegynder
23. marts 2004 - 21:43 #4
nu kan det godt være jeg spørger lidt dumt, men står nu med denne commando promt - er det det samme som at være logget ind som root  ?

sh-2.05b#

Dvs. jeg er kommet ind i rescue mode - kan jeg ændre i filen herfra ?
Avatar billede Slettet bruger
23. marts 2004 - 21:57 #5
Jeg kender som sagt ikke RH men jeg vil da tro at du skal skrive
root -> klik enter
og derefter password, giver systemet ikke muligheden "boot installed system" eller lign??
Avatar billede zoq Nybegynder
23. marts 2004 - 22:01 #6
jo den skriver

** Dit system er monteret i kataloget /mnt/sysimage
** Når du er færdig afslut skallen for at starte systemet igen.

sh-2.05b#

men øv jeg kan ikke skrive "root" det hjælper ikke rigtigt.... :o( som du kan høre er jeg lidt n00b...
Avatar billede zoq Nybegynder
23. marts 2004 - 22:06 #7
ahhh tror måske jeg fandt lidt ud af det. Nu har jeg mounted den...
troede bare der ville komme noget som lignede det her

sh-2.05b etc#
men den står bare sådan her
sh-2.05b#
selvom man er inde i "etc"
Avatar billede zoq Nybegynder
23. marts 2004 - 22:14 #8
jeg er inde i filen nu!!!

Primary Master - Linux Fedora Core 1

Secondary Master - CD-ROM
Seconddary Slave - Windows 2003

og min fil ser sådan her ud - kan du hjælpe med at ændre det til det rigtige
--------------------------------------------------------------------------

default=0
timeout=10
splashimage=(hd2,0)/grub/splash.xpm.gz
title Fedora Core (2.4.22-1.2115.nptl)
        root (hd2,0)
        kernel /vmlinuz-2.4.22-1.215.nptl ro root=LABEL=/ rhgb
        initrd /initrd-2.4.22-1.2115.nptl.img
title Windows 2003 server
        rootnoverify (hd0,0)
        chainloader +1
Avatar billede Slettet bruger
24. marts 2004 - 08:09 #9
Det er lidt vanskeligt det her da du jo vist nok er temmelig ny ud i Linux, så lad os prøve at få det til at køre først. Træk fladkablet ud af di Windows harddisk og start op som du gjorde i aftes, skriv nu
grub  -> klik enter
når du ser "grub" prompten skriver du
setup (hd0) -> klik enter
Denne lille manøvre vil bevirke at du indlæser "grub" i MBR på din Linux harddisk men
det virker kun hvis der ikke er lavet for meget rav i det du skal sørge for at din harddisk er jumpet og placeret helt som da du installerede RH
Avatar billede Slettet bruger
24. marts 2004 - 12:32 #10
RETTELSE !!!!
Efter du har jumpet din harddisk til at køre som primær master skal du ændre din /menu.lst til
"default=0
timeout=10
splashimage=(hd0,0)/boot/grub/splash.xpm.gz
title Red Hat Linux (2.4.20-8)
root (hd0,0)
kernel /boot/vmlinuz-2.4.20-8 ro root=LABEL=/ rhgb
initrd /initrd-2.4.22-1.2115.nptl.img" (uden"")
og herefter skal du skrive til MBR, husk at afslutte grub det gøres med kommandoen quit
Avatar billede Slettet bruger
24. marts 2004 - 12:38 #11
Rent sludder

default=0
timeout=10
splashimage=(hd0,0)/boot/grub/splash.xpm.gz
title Fedora Core (2.4.22-1.2115.nptl)
 
root (hd0,0)
kernel /vmlinuz-2.4.22-1.215.nptl ro root=LABEL=/ rhgb
    initrd /initrd-2.4.22-1.2115.nptl.img

Her skulle den vist være
Avatar billede zoq Nybegynder
24. marts 2004 - 21:53 #12
kom fint ind i resuce-mode og grub "mode", men kan ikke rigtig skrive
setup (hd0)

:o(

Jeg har pillet min Windows disk helt fra nu og nu sidder det sådan her
Primary Master - Linux
Secondary Master - CD-ROM
Avatar billede zoq Nybegynder
24. marts 2004 - 21:54 #13
Får denne fejl når jeg skriver setup (hd0)

Error 12: Invalid device requested
Avatar billede zoq Nybegynder
24. marts 2004 - 21:58 #14
# For installing GRUB into the hard disk
title Install GRUB into the hard disk
root    (hd0,0)
setup  (hd0)

-------------------------
Prøvede overstående så kom jeg lidt videre :o)
Avatar billede zoq Nybegynder
24. marts 2004 - 22:07 #15
Så lader det til at virke igen! MANGE TAK!!Jeg har dog stadig et lille problem når jeg booter op "failer" den ved denne...

Activating swap partitions: swap on /dev/hdd3: No such device or address
Avatar billede Slettet bruger
25. marts 2004 - 07:26 #16
Det er fordi din SWAP partition er angivet forkert i /etc/fstab, som du har jumpet nu ligger din SWAP partition på /dev/hda?? det kan du ændre i /etc/fstab
Avatar billede zoq Nybegynder
25. marts 2004 - 21:38 #17
hmm det virker ikke - nu har jeg prøvet med
/dev/hda
og
/dev/hda1

kan det være andet ?
Avatar billede Slettet bruger
25. marts 2004 - 22:06 #18
Normalt skal du åbne din konsol/terminal der skriver du
fdisk /dev/hda -> klik enter
herefter åbner du den menu der vist nok hedder "list" eller "print"
her kan du se hvilket nummer der er din swap partition, gå ud af fdisk ved at skrive quit og gå ind og rediger i /etc/fstab
Avatar billede zoq Nybegynder
25. marts 2004 - 22:16 #19
må jeg godt få din hjerne... :)

ligger du et svar?
Avatar billede Slettet bruger
28. marts 2004 - 21:33 #20
God sommer
Avatar billede zoq Nybegynder
28. marts 2004 - 21:39 #21
i lige måde
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ester